Deeply rooted in the values of compassion, Tarachand Ramnath Seva Trust’s Joy of Giving is a program that gathers communities inspired to give back to society. The program offers booklets and gift certificates of up to INR 1 lakh to selected individuals.
The purpose of the program is to enable individuals to become socially active. The participants are given the freedom to choose the initiatives they resonate with the most, to encourage more involvement, and, thus, make it an intimate experience. Personalized giving and the essence of social consciousness cultivated in the people are what make Joy of Giving stand apart. This program nurtures cultural values and simultaneously, makes an impact.

Designed an event on awareness about Environment Protection and the Conservation of Energy and Resources.
• Impacted around 2000 students in 100 schools in PMC
• 25 awareness sessions in and around Pune will be conducted -
Generated green renewable energy from 15 kg of waste at Apulki Old Age Home, helping them save fuel energy worth 15 LPG cylinders per year.
• Cost saving of around INR 30,000 per year on fossil fuel

Gave math and science tuition to children. They also offer extracurricular activities for development.
• Trained 12 students in singing.
• 115 students were taught the English module
• 70 students from 7th grade were given science and maths tuition.
• 30 students from 8th grade were given science tuition
• Total 227 students were provided with books and study materials for the modules -
Provided essentials like blankets, towel/napkins, mats to the hospital that provides free of cost treatment to cancer patients.
• Provided a 25 bedded hospital for cancer patients, especially for women from socio-economically backward sections
-
Provided treatment to old age beggars by purchasing Interferential therapy (IFT) equipment.
• Treating the health problems of 5 old age beggars per day
• 75 to 100 old age beggars through IFT machines per month
